Cog In The Machine by Afraid of Robots published on 2022-05-23T14:29:55Z Spanning from the innocent to chaotic, "Cog In The Machine" is an epic adventure into the unknown future of the world we live in today. In the beginning there was a time when humans lived in an analog world. It was a difficult life. All work was done by hand. All thought was done by the mind. Until the day came when the humans decided they would break free from their analog lives and enter a new age of being human. The digital age. Insidiously, the new digital world took control of the human’s lives. Slowly, the machine extended outward into the darkness reaching the humans so profoundly that it changed the very nature of who they were. Mindlessly consuming whatever came before them, the humans became cogs in a machine they no longer controlled. Unwilling to think for themselves, they could not escape from the digital nexus they had created. But there, in the distance, was a signal. A signal so faint, it barely could be heard. The signal persisted, calling out to their unconscious minds triggering their primal instincts to break free from what they had become and embrace the freedom of the signal that was now almost musical. The signal grew louder and louder, now beginning to overcome the control of the machine. Suddenly, the humans awoke to the world they lived in, and began to contemplate the technology they had created. The signal reminded them of what they had gained, and what they had lost. It was an aide-memoire of the analog life they had abandoned, as they moved forward into an uncertain future.
